◆ execute()

StatusCode AthenaMon::execute ( const EventContext & ctx)
virtual

Execute method.

Provides access to the EventContext if needed but is non-const as opposed to AthReentrantAlgorithm.

Implements AthAlgorithm.

Definition at line 96 of file AthenaMon.cxx.

97{
98
99 MsgStream log(msgSvc(), name());
100
101 log << MSG::DEBUG << "executing AthenaMon algorithm" << endmsg;
102
103 //Invoke all declared alg monitoring tools to fill their histograms
104 std::vector<IMonitorToolBase*>::iterator it = m_monTools.begin();
105
106 for (; it < m_monTools.end(); ++it) {
107 if((*it)->preSelector())
108 if((*it)->fillHists(ctx).isFailure()) {
109 log << MSG::WARNING << "Error Filling Histograms" << endmsg;
110 // return StatusCode::FAILURE;
111 }
112 }
113 if(m_eventCounter==0) {
114 //Invoke periodically all declared alg monitoring tools to check their histograms
115 it = m_monTools.begin();
116
117 for (; it < m_monTools.end(); ++it) {
118 log << MSG::INFO << "calling checkHists of tool " << endmsg;
119 StatusCode sc = (*it)->checkHists(false);
120 if(sc.isFailure()) {
121 log << MSG::WARNING << "Can\'t call checkHists of tool." << endmsg;
122 // return StatusCode::FAILURE;
123 }
124 }
126 }
128 return StatusCode::SUCCESS;
129}

◆ initialize()

StatusCode AthenaMon::initialize ( )
virtual

Definition at line 44 of file AthenaMon.cxx.

46{
47 MsgStream log(msgSvc(), name());
48 log << MSG::INFO << "initialize AthenaMon algorithm" << endmsg;
49
50 std::vector<std::string>::iterator it = m_monToolNames.begin();
51 SmartIF<IToolSvc> p_toolSvc{service("ToolSvc")};
52 ATH_CHECK( p_toolSvc.isValid() );
53
54 for (; it < m_monToolNames.end(); ++it) {
55
56 std::string toolname(*it);
57 IMonitorToolBase* p_tool;
58
59 Gaudi::Utils::TypeNameString mytool(toolname);
60
61 StatusCode sc = p_toolSvc->retrieveTool(mytool.type(), mytool.name(), p_tool);
62 if(sc.isFailure()) {
63 log << MSG::FATAL << "Unable to create " << toolname
64 << " AlgTool" << endmsg;
65 return StatusCode::FAILURE;
66 } else {
67
68 log << MSG::INFO
69 << "Tool Name = " << toolname
70 << endmsg;
71
73 if(sc.isFailure()) {
74 log << MSG::WARNING << "Unable to setup the OutPutStreams in "
75 << toolname << endmsg;
76 }
77
78 // shall I book histograms now ?
80 {
81 // Try to book the histograms now. If the tool uses
82 // dynamic booking, it should define bookHists as empty.
83 sc = p_tool->bookHists();
84 if(sc.isFailure()) {
85 log << MSG::WARNING << "Unable to book in " << toolname << endmsg;
86 }
87 }
88 m_monTools.push_back(p_tool);
89 }
90 }
92 return StatusCode::SUCCESS;
93}

◆ sysInitialize()

StatusCode AthAlgorithm::sysInitialize ( )
overridevirtualinherited

Override sysInitialize.

Override sysInitialize from the base class.

Loop through all output handles, and if they're WriteCondHandles, automatically register them and this Algorithm with the CondSvc.

Scan through all outputHandles, and if they're WriteCondHandles, register them with the CondSvc

Reimplemented from AthCommonDataStore< AthCommonMsg< Gaudi::Algorithm > >.

Reimplemented in AthAnalysisAlgorithm, AthFilterAlgorithm, AthHistogramAlgorithm, and PyAthena::Alg.

Definition at line 66 of file AthAlgorithm.cxx.

66 {
68
69 if (sc.isFailure()) {
70 return sc;
71 }
72 ServiceHandle<ICondSvc> cs("CondSvc",name());
73 for (auto h : outputHandles()) {
74 if (h->isCondition() && h->mode() == Gaudi::DataHandle::Writer) {
75 // do this inside the loop so we don't create the CondSvc until needed
76 if ( cs.retrieve().isFailure() ) {
77 ATH_MSG_WARNING("no CondSvc found: won't autoreg WriteCondHandles");
78 return StatusCode::SUCCESS;
79 }
80 if (cs->regHandle(this,*h).isFailure()) {
81 sc = StatusCode::FAILURE;
82 ATH_MSG_ERROR("unable to register WriteCondHandle " << h->fullKey()
83 << " with CondSvc");
84 }
85 }
86 }
87 return sc;
88}
